湿法气流床气化系统中氯离子对装置选材的影响 被引量:1

Impact of Chloride Ion on Material Selection for Entrained Flow Coal-water Slurry(CWS) Gasification System

摘要 分析了湿法气流床气化系统中氯离子的来源、质量浓度及氯离子的腐蚀机理、危害。针对高硫低氯、高硫高氯、低硫高氯3种氯离子腐蚀情况进行探讨,提出湿法气流床气化装置应对氯离子腐蚀的选材原则及采取的相应措施:增加废水排放量,降低系统氯离子浓度;合理选材;增加内衬,提高设备及管道的防腐能力。并提出了防止氯离子腐蚀的一些建议。 The source and mass concentration of chloride ion,and its corrosion mechanism and harm in the entrained flow coal-water slurry gasification system were analyzed.Chlorine corrosion of high-sulfur and low-chloride, high-sulfur and high-chlorine,low-sulfur and high-chloride were discussed.Suggestions on and the principles of material selection about improving the entrained flow CWS-gasification equipment as well as corrosion resistance to chloride ion were proposed.
